main
, nav
ve aside
gibi HTML5 öğeleri, ekran okuyucuların ve diğer yardımcı teknolojilerin sayfadaki özel bölgelere veya yer işaretlerine atlayabileceği özel bölgeler olarak işlev görür.
Yer işareti öğelerini kullanarak, yardımcı teknoloji kullanıcıları için sitenizdeki gezinme deneyimini önemli ölçüde iyileştirebilirsiniz.
Daha fazla bilgi için Deque University'nin HTML 5 ve ARIA Dönüm Noktaları başlıklı makalesine göz atın.
Dönüm noktalarını manuel olarak kontrol etme
Sayfanızın her ana bölümünün bir yer işareti öğesi içerdiğini kontrol etmek için W3C'nin yer işareti öğeleri listesini kullanın. Örneğin:
<header>
<p>Put product name and logo here</p>
</header>
<nav>
<ul>
<li>Put navigation here</li>
</ul>
</nav>
<main>
<p>Put main content here</p>
</main>
<footer>
<p>Put copyright info, supplemental links, etc. here</p>
</footer>
Sayfa yapınızı görselleştirmek ve yer işaretlerinde bulunmayan bölümleri yakalamak için Microsoft'un Erişilebilirlik Analizleri uzantısı gibi araçları da kullanabilirsiniz:

Dönüm noktalarını etkili bir şekilde kullanma
<div>
veya<span>
gibi genel öğelere güvenmek yerine, sayfanızı önemli bölümlere ayırmak için yer işareti öğelerini kullanın.- Sayfanızın yapısını belirtmek için yer işaretlerini kullanın.
Örneğin,
<main>
öğesi sayfanın ana fikriyle doğrudan ilgili tüm içeriği içermelidir. Bu nedenle, sayfa başına yalnızca bir tane olmalıdır. Her bir yer işaretinin nasıl kullanılacağını öğrenmek için MDN'nin içerik bölümlendirme öğeleriyle ilgili özetine bakın. - Dönüm noktalarını dikkatli bir şekilde kullanın. Çok fazla yer işareti olması, yardımcı teknoloji kullanıcılarının istedikleri içeriğe kolayca atlamasını engellediği için gezinmeyi daha zorlaştırabilir.
Daha fazla bilgi için Başlıklar ve yer işaretleri başlıklı makaleyi inceleyin.